Brief summary
Neuro Optica is an Australian company that has developed a proprietary eye-tracking platform, using an application via a smartphone, to assess brain function (BrainEye). The application is currently categorised as a wellness device (non-medical) and as such does not fall under the Therapeutic Goods Administration as regulated under the Therapeutic Goods Act. Accordingly, fundamental research studies of the application have not been conducted to Good Clinical. Practice (GCP) or ISO 14155 standards. Neuro Optica is now proposing that the device be classified as a low risk SaMD (Class 1 medical device), capable of measuring and analysing ocular movements, although with results used for information only, i.e., not for clinical diagnosis. Although clinical trials are not required to support this proposal, Neuro Optica wish to substantiate its labelling claims to the market by conducting a clinical trial on a small number of participants (n=30), validating its smooth pursuit and pupillary light reflex measures against gold standard device measures. We hypothesis that all BrainEye measures of latency, velocity, amplitude and accuracy will correlate significantly with gold standard device measures.
Interventions
Eye movements have been used for decades to interrogate neurological function, and we have an extensive understanding of the consequences of a broad range of neurological disorders on eye movements. BrainEye is a smartphone application that uses AI, machine learning, and cloud based technology to record and anlayse the location of the eye in space over time, with a view to providing a snapshot of neurological function in an individual over time. The BrainEye application is classified as a low risk SaMD (Class 1 medical device), capable of measuring and analysing ocular movements, although with results used for information only, i.e., not for clinical diagnosis. Although clinical trials are not required to support this proposal, Neuro Optica will substantiate its labelling claims to the market by conducting a clinical trial on a small number of participants (n=30), validating its smooth pursuit and pupillary light reflex measures against gold standard measures. This study will be conducted to GCP and ISO 14155 standards under the Clinical Trial Notification (CTN) scheme. Specifcally, over a single testing session smooth pursuit eye movements and the pupillary light reflex will be measured using the BrainEye application on a smartphone as well as three gold standard devices. These devices are the Neuroptic NPI Pupillometer (to measure the pupillary light reflex) and the EyeLink portable Duo video-oculography system and Tobii Pro Glasses 3 (to meaure smooth pursuit eye movements). To measure the pupillary light reflex a flash of light will be delivered to the participants eyes, and to measure smooth pursuit eye movements, participants will be asked to fixate and/or follow a moving dot across the smartphone screen for the BrainEye applicaton or a computer screen for EyeLink and Tobii systems. Testing will take no longer than 45 minutes and will be conducted at Monash University, Alfred Centre.

Eligibility
Inclusion criteria
• Healthy volunteer or diagnosis of a neurological condition ( Parkinson's, Multiple slerosis, dementia, epilepsy) • Age 18 years or over • Written informed consent prior to participation • Able to verbally communicate well with the investigator, to understand and comply with the requirements of the study • If female, not pregnant or breast feeding
Exclusion criteria
• History of cognitive deficit • History of attention deficit disorder • Previously diagnosed concussion (within the past year) • History of intracranial disease • History of unresolved strabismus, diplopia, amblyopia • History of unresolved cranial nerve III, IV or VI palsy • History of unresolved macular oedema, retinal degeneration, extensive cataract, or ocular globe disruption • History of unresolved extensive corneal surgery or scarring • Lack of two functional eyes • Unresolved ocular motor dysfunction • Obvious intoxication or impairment that limits ability to participate • Imaging abnormality (i.e., fracture or bleed) • Unable to come in for follow-up visits • Any medical condition which, in the view of the Investigator, is likely to interfere with the study or put the participant at risk • Currently enrolled in another clinical study
